Scatter plots
- In the attached '.mat' file you will find vectors 'x' and 'y'. Perform a scatter plot to reveal what is often called the most beatiful equation in all of mathematics.
After plotting, use:
1- axis equal;
... to ensure it is displayed in the proper aspect ratio for readability.
Type the identity into the text box below.
EulerIdentity.mat
When I have responded and the answer was incorrect, the following is suggested:
Incorrecto
Type the text exactly as you see it in the scatter plot. There are no spaces in the answer.
I don't think I quite understand what you're asking. Because my doubt is that when I generate the scatter plot nowhere in the graph it tells me something that suggests an answer. I don't know what I'm missing when I make the graph. If you could help me, I would be very grateful.

Try using scatter(x,y) instead of plot(x,y). Doing so, you might see the data forms letters that you are then supposed to type in somewhere in the assignment.
